I guess the downside is it's visible so not much use if the car is stolen or tracking a rogue employee, they can just unplug it..
I have a 300mm obd extension lead fitted, so it tucks up behind the dash, and cannot be seen, at the end of day it's a cheap way to track your car, all the drivers will know that it is fitted, it's a deterrent.

If they decide to unplug it, it will send you a text message telling you it has been removed!!! Big brother is watching them!!!

Couple of questions.....you say(Sean) no app is needed? How do you get the info and map up on pc or phone?

There is a slot for a sim card.......is this needed all the time or for certain trackings etc??

You will need to log on the Web site, I cannot remember the full site address but it is made by Capcare, Sean has the full details from there you can also download the app for android and iPhone.

Yes you will need a sim card for it to track the vehicle I brought a O2 sim and put £10 on it which should last the best part of a year.
